Conservatives are almost an endangered species in YW, and the NDP are not much stronger. The Liberals have held this seat since Red Kelly took it from the Tories in 1962. The NDP mounted a threat in 1972 but fell several thousand votes short. The last time the Conservatives came within 6,000 votes of winning was in 1984, when Brian Mulroney swept the country. This may not be the safest Liberal seat in Canada, but it is surely very close. |

The CHP (Christian Heritage Party) actually had quite a respectable showing here in 2004. Regardless, they ended up with only 1,580 votes. The reality remains, however, that York West is the Mount Royal of Ontario. This is a bedrock Liberal riding. Sgro, liked or not liked, won’t change that result. The Liberals could run a ventriloquist's dummy here and it would win. This is a solid red riding plain and simple. |
